United Parcel Service Inc Price to Book Ratio (P/B) on June 03, 2024: 7.00

United Parcel Service Inc Price to Book Ratio (P/B) is 7.00 on June 03, 2024, a -3.02% change year over year. The price to book ratio compares the market price per share of a company's stock to its book value per share. It is calculated by dividing the market capitalization by the shareholders' equity minus treasury stock, divided by the number of outstanding shares. This ratio provides insights into how the market values a company relative to its book value. A ratio above 1 indicates the market values the company more than its book value, suggesting positive market sentiment.
  • United Parcel Service Inc 52-week high Price to Book Ratio (P/B) is 8.11 on July 24, 2023, which is 15.82% above the current Price to Book Ratio (P/B).
  • United Parcel Service Inc 52-week low Price to Book Ratio (P/B) is 5.44 on February 14, 2024, which is -22.29% below the current Price to Book Ratio (P/B).
  • United Parcel Service Inc average Price to Book Ratio (P/B) for the last 52 weeks is 7.16.

Description

United Parcel Service, Inc., a package delivery company, provides transportation and delivery, distribution, contract logistics, ocean freight, airfreight, customs brokerage, and insurance services. It operates through two segments, U.S. Domestic Package and International Package. The U.S. Domestic Package segment offers time-definite delivery of express letters, documents, small packages, and palletized freight through air and ground services in the United States. The International Package segment provides guaranteed day and time-definite international shipping services comprising guaranteed time-definite express options in Europe, Asia, the Indian sub-continent, the Middle East, Africa, Canada, and Latin America. The company also offers international air and ocean freight forwarding, post-sales, and mail and consulting services. In addition, it provides truckload and customs brokerage services; supply chain solutions to the healthcare and life sciences industries; fulfillment and transportation management services; and integrated supply chain and shipment insurance solutions. United Parcel Service, Inc. was founded in 1907 and is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ia.
